Unleashing Intelligence: Breakthrough AI Camera Features
The Google Pixel 10 Pro AI Camera is brimming with intelligent features designed to elevate every shot, from casual snapshots to artistic endeavors. These advancements are deeply integrated into the camera experience, often working behind the scenes to deliver stunning results.
- Pro Zoom (formerly ProRes Zoom): One of the most remarkable features is the ability to achieve an astonishing 100x zoom on the Pixel 10 Pro models. This isn’t merely digital cropping; it leverages a new on-device AI generative imaging model and the Tensor G5 chip to fill in vague or missing details, resulting in remarkably crisp images even at extreme magnifications. Google saves both the original and the AI-enhanced versions, giving users control over the final output.
- Auto Best Take: Say goodbye to unflattering group photos. Auto Best Take analyzes multiple shots of a group and intelligently combines the best facial expressions from each to ensure everyone looks their absolute best in a single, perfect image.
- Camera Coach: For those moments when you need a little guidance, Camera Coach acts as your personal photography tutor. Utilizing Gemini AI, this feature provides real-time tips on lighting, composition, exposure, and brightness, helping you frame and capture superior photos.
- AI-Powered Editing in Google Photos: Editing has become more intuitive than ever. Users can simply describe the desired changes in natural language, and Google Photos, powered by Gemini models, will understand, interpret, and instantly apply those edits. This can range from specific lighting adjustments to broader framing updates, or even a simple “Fix this.”
- Video Boost & Enhanced Stabilization: The Pixel 10 Pro brings significant improvements to video. Video Boost enhances video quality, lighting, colors, and details, and provides better stabilization. For Pro models, this feature can even upscale video to 8K at 24/30p using cloud-based AI processing. The Pro models also feature an improved optical image stabilization module with twice the range of compensation, ensuring smoother video capture even without AI intervention.
- Improved Real Tone: Google’s commitment to inclusive photography continues with enhanced Real Tone, which seamlessly captures varying skin tones for everyone in a photo or video, presenting each person in their most authentic light.
- Macro Focus: Both the ultrawide and telephoto lenses on the Pixel 10 Pro are equipped with Macro Focus, allowing for detailed close-up photography at different lengths.
- Reimage and Add Me Tools: These advanced AI tools, part of Google’s Magic Editor suite, enable users to select any area of a photo and describe what they want to appear in that spot. This means you can transform surroundings or even add new subjects to your images.

Under the Hood: The Synergy of Hardware and AI
The remarkable capabilities of the Google Pixel 10 Pro AI Camera are not solely reliant on software; they are deeply rooted in a powerful synergy between cutting-edge hardware and Google’s custom-designed silicon.
The Google Tensor G5 Chip
At the heart of the Pixel 10 Pro’s intelligence is the Google Tensor G5 chip. This is Google’s latest custom-designed system-on-chip (SoC), representing a significant leap in performance and AI processing.
- Advanced Manufacturing: The Tensor G5 is reportedly fabricated by TSMC using a 3-nanometer process node, allowing for greater transistor density and improved efficiency.
- Performance Boost: The G5 delivers a major performance upgrade, featuring an up to 60% more powerful Tensor Processing Unit (TPU) and a 34% faster CPU on average compared to its predecessor. This enhanced power makes the Pixel more responsive for everyday tasks and, crucially, for running the latest AI features.
- Custom Image Signal Processor (ISP): The G5 integrates a redesigned, fully custom Image Signal Processor (ISP) that works in tandem with the TPU. This custom ISP is crucial for Pixel’s camera dominance, enabling higher-quality videos, improved low-light performance, motion deblur, and 10-bit video capture by default for 1080p and 4k30.
- On-Device AI: The Tensor G5 unlocks the most advanced on-device AI on any phone, efficiently running Google’s newest Gemini Nano model. This allows for faster, more private, and more sophisticated AI experiences directly on the device, minimizing reliance on cloud processing for complex generative AI models.
Pixel 10 Pro Camera Hardware Specifications
The Google Pixel 10 Pro AI Camera system features a robust triple-lens setup on the rear, complemented by a high-resolution front-facing camera. While the Pro models largely retain the camera hardware from the Pixel 9 series, the Tensor G5 and its advanced AI capabilities unlock significantly enhanced performance and new features.
Camera TypeSpecificationPrimary Wide50MP, f/1.68 aperture, 1/1.3-inch sensor size, 82-degree Field of View (FoV), Optical Image Stabilization (OIS)Ultrawide48MP, f/1.7 aperture, 1/2.55-inch sensor size, 123-degree FoVPeriscope Telephoto48MP, f/2.8 aperture, 1/2.55-inch sensor size, 22-degree FoV, 5x optical zoom, OISFront-Facing42MP
The improved optical image stabilization module in the Pro models further enhances image and video clarity, especially in challenging conditions.
